Fort Western - Augusta, Fort Western was a colonial outpost at the head of navigation on the Kennebec River at modern Augusta, Maine. It was built in 1754 by a Boston land company to promote settlement in the area. The fort was a log palisade with blockhouses which protected a store and warehouse. It was never directly attacked. From a high elevation a large rectangular enclosure commanded the river for more than a mile. Blockhouses 24 feet square and watch-boxes 12 feet square guarded opposite corners, and within stood a two-story main house 100 feet by 32 feet.

Joshua L. Chamberlain Museum - Brunswick, The Joshua L. Chamberlain Museum was the home of American Civil War general, Bowdoin College president, and Maine governor Joshua L. Chamberlain for over 50 years. Located at the corner of Maine and Potter Streets in Brunswick, Maine, the house is now open to the public and is in the process of being restored as it was when Chamberlain lived there.

Maine State Museum - Augusta, The Maine State Museum is the official Maine government's museum and is located at 230 State Street, adjacent to the Maine State House, in Augusta, . The State Museum has a large collection of Maine-related topics. The Lion is displayed at the museum and is the oldest American-made locomotive in New England. Major Reuben Colburn House - , Pittston, The Major Reuben Colburn House was the home of Reuben Colburn, a patriot and shipbuilder of Pittston, Maine from 1765 to 1818. Colburn assisted George Washington and Benedict Arnold in the planning and provisioning of the invasion of Canada. Arnold's expedition to seize Quebec from the British Army in 1775 during the American Revolutionary War began here.

Nickels-Sortwell House - Wiscasset, The Nickels-Sortwell House, that can be found on the main street of Wiscasset, Maine in the US, was built in 1807 by Captain William Nickels, a ship owner and trader. The style and age of the building reflect "a period when shipbuilding and the maritime trade brought prosperity and sophisticated tastes to this riverside community."

Old Post Office (Liberty, Maine) - Liberty, The Old Post Office, which is also referred to as the Old Octagonal Post Office, was built in 1870 and is an historic octagon-shaped former U.S. post office building located on Main Street in Liberty, Maine. On June 19, 1973, it was added to the National Register of Historic Places. The town of Liberty boasts that the building is "the only octagonal post office in the US". The building, which "has all its original equipment" is now the home of the Liberty Historical Society, which opens it to the public on Saturdays during the summer.

Peary–MacMillan Arctic Museum - Brunswick, The Peary-MacMillan Arctic Museum is a museum that is situated in Hubbard Hall at Bowdoin College in Brunswick, Maine. Named for Arctic explorers and Bowdoin College graduates Robert E. Peary and Donald B. MacMillan, it is the only museum in the US dedicated completely to Arctic Studies.
